Matusiewicz
Polish
surname
, which translates to, "
Son of
Bear
."
The surname Matusiewicz comes from the ancient-Lithuanian "
Matus
" ("bear") and the Polish extension "ewicz" ("
Son of
"). This means the
verbatim
English translation of Matusiewicz would be "Bearson" (the "
son of
bear").
